Generally speaking:
Moog cc822 - Standard issue coils on long boxes, Supercabs, & 4x4's
Moog cc824 - Heavy duty for F150s that came with cc822's & standard duty for 2wd F250's with the small block motors.
Moog cc844 - Standard issue on 2wd F250 big blocks/diesel motors & heavy duty for 2wd F250's with cc824's
